Mnuchin Risks Becoming Trump's Target as Market Slide Worsens
(Bloomberg) -- Steven Mnuchin is struggling to contain his first real crisis as Treasury secretary, failing to assuage investors unnerved by turmoil in Washington and making him a target of President Donald Trumps wrath over stock market losses.
An emergency meeting with top U.S. regulators that Mnuchin convened on Monday and a call with executives from six major banks the previous day failed to address concerns about the administration that have intensified in the wake of a Bloomberg News report that Trump had discussed firing Federal Reserve Chairman Jerome Powell.
Trumps frustration with Powell over the markets performance -- expressed in tweets and interviews -- now may turn to his Treasury chief. One person familiar with the presidents thinking says that Trump has weighed dismissing Mnuchin, while another said that Mnuchins tenure may depend in part on how much markets continue to drop.
Since taking office, Trump has looked to the stock market as a benchmark for his presidency. Yet much of the gains in equities since his election have been been erased by months of turmoil, as investors grow increasingly concerned about the impact of the administrations trade battles with China and Europe.
